We are looking for an experienced Commercial Gas Engineer to join our team, working across Ipswich and the surrounding areas. This is a full-time, permanent role offering a competitive salary and consistent workload.
The role will involve carrying out installation, servicing, maintenance and repair of commercial gas systems and appliances. You will be responsible for diagnosing faults, completing repairs efficiently, and ensuring all work is carried out safely and in line with current gas regulations. Accurate completion of job paperwork and a professional approach when dealing with clients are essential.
Responsibilities- Carry out installation, servicing, maintenance and repair of commercial gas systems and appliances.
- Diagnose faults and complete repairs efficiently.
- Ensure all work is carried out safely and in line with current gas regulations.
- Accurately complete job paperwork and maintain a professional approach when dealing with clients.
- Hold valid commercial gas qualifications such as COCN1 and CODNCO1 (or equivalent) and be Gas Safe registered.
- Previous experience working on commercial gas systems is required.
- Full UK driving licence.
- Ability to work independently, manage time effectively, and produce high-quality work.
